Okay, from searching previous posts, it appears the AX4N is the tranny to look for. One post said to look for an "X" on the door sticker...what door sticker is this? I live somewhat far from where most of these used cars will be located, so I need to know how to walk the salesman or owner through the ID steps by phone.
Also, if the car has the AX4S but it's rebuilt, what should I look for on a rebuild receipt that might indicate the trans has been upgraded?
You want to look on the "Vehicle Certification Label" (a/k/a the door sticker). You will see on the sticker a "TR" designation, and underneath that there will either be an "L" (AX4S) or an "X" (AX4N).
Many times a tranny will have a sticker on it with some rebuild info if the unit has been rebuilt by Ford, but I'm not sure if tranny shops do the same thing to their rebuilds.
